About random dinosaur names
Real dinosaur names are built like Lego bricks from Greek and Latin roots. The genus usually describes a body part, a behavior, or a place: Triceratops is "three-horned face," Velociraptor is "swift thief," Pachycephalosaurus is "thick-headed lizard," and Utahraptor and Albertosaurus tell you where the bones were found. Common endings signal the family: -saurus (lizard), -raptor (thief), -ceratops (horned face), -don (tooth), -mimus (mimic), -lophus (crest), -titan (giant sauropod), -pelta (shield, for armored dinosaurs), and -venator (hunter). Stack a descriptive root on one of those suffixes and you have a name a paleontologist would nod at.
Invented species names in fiction and games follow exactly the same rules, which is why Ignisaurus (fire lizard), Glacioraptor (ice thief), or Coronaceratops (crown horned face) sound plausible next to real genera. Pet and character dinosaurs, on the other hand, get names the way dogs do: Rexy and Blue from Jurassic World, Littlefoot and Cera from The Land Before Time, Arlo from The Good Dinosaur, or plain descriptive nicknames like Spike, Chomper, and Stompy.

Tips for choosing a name
- To invent a believable species, pair a Latin or Greek descriptor (ignis, umbra, ferrum, aquila) with a family suffix such as -saurus, -raptor, -ceratops, or -don, and check that the meaning matches the animal's look.
- For a pet or story dinosaur, use a short punchy nickname (Spike, Rexy, Chomper) or a comically gentle one (Tiny, Nibbles, Peewee) for a huge animal; the contrast does a lot of characterization for free.
- Match the name to the group: -raptor and -venator names read as fast predators, -titan names as enormous sauropods, and -pelta or -ceratops names as armored or horned herbivores.
- If you are writing for children, add a species-based nickname the way The Land Before Time did (Longneck, Threehorn, Sharptooth) so young readers can picture the animal instantly.
- Real genus names are not trademarked, so Tyrannosaurus or Triceratops are free to use, but specific character names like Rexy or Littlefoot belong to their franchises and are best used only as inspiration.
Frequently asked questions
How do dinosaurs get their scientific names?
The paleontologist who formally describes a new species chooses the name, usually from Greek or Latin roots describing a feature (Triceratops, three-horned face), a location (Utahraptor), or a person (Leaellynasaura, named after the discoverer's daughter). The name must be published and follow the rules of zoological nomenclature.
What does -saurus mean and why do so many dinosaur names end with it?
Saurus comes from the Greek sauros, meaning lizard, and it was the default ending early naturalists used for large fossil reptiles. Other common endings include -raptor (thief), -don (tooth), -ceratops (horned face), and -mimus (mimic).

Can I use a made-up dinosaur name in my book or game?
Yes. Names you build from Latin and Greek roots, like the invented species in this list, are free to use commercially. Just double-check that your invention has not already been used for a real, published genus if scientific accuracy matters to your project.
